Incorporating **keto heart-healthy foods** into your diet is a great way to ensure you're supporting your heart while adhering to a ketogenic lifestyle. Some top **heart-healthy keto foods** include avocados, which are rich in monounsaturated fats, and salmon, which is packed with omega-3 fatty acids. Nuts and seeds are also excellent choices, supplying both healthy fats and fiber. Leafy greens like spinach and kale are low in carbs but high in nutrients, making them perfect additions to any **ketogenic diet**. By selecting these **cardioprotective keto foods**, you can enjoy a varied and nutritious diet that supports heart health.
